NASCAR penalized Kevin Harvick’s Stewart-Haas Racing’s No. 4 team on Wednesday for two violations relating to a rear-window malfunction on Harvick’s Las Vegas-winning car on Sunday.
NASCAR rules dictate that the rear window support braces must keep the rear window glass rigid in all directions at all times. The right side rocker panel extension did not meet NASCAR rule specifications, as it was not an aluminum extension.
The team has three days to decide whether or not to appeal the penalty.
Harvick’s victory at the Pennzoil 400 at Las Vegas Motor Speedway was his second consecutive win this season.
